Understanding Wire Mesh Gauge Sizes for Optimal Performance and Applications
Understanding wire mesh gauge sizes is crucial across numerous industries, from construction and agriculture to security and environmental protection. The precise specifications of wire mesh, dictated by its gauge, directly impact its strength, durability, and suitability for a given application. Globally, the demand for reliable and appropriately specified wire mesh is consistently high, driven by infrastructure development, increasing safety regulations, and a growing need for effective filtration and containment solutions. The significance of correct wire mesh gauge sizes extends beyond mere functionality. Improperly gauged mesh can lead to structural failures, compromised security, and inefficient processes – resulting in costly repairs, safety hazards, and reduced operational effectiveness. Standardized sizing ensures interoperability, simplifies procurement, and allows for accurate engineering calculations. The economic impact is considerable, particularly in large-scale projects. Furthermore, advancements in materials science and manufacturing techniques are constantly refining the possibilities within wire mesh gauge sizes, leading to lighter, stronger, and more corrosion-resistant options.
